One way to repurpose an oddly shaped urban lot? Turn it into the world’s most colorful basketball court. That’s the idea behind this creation from French fashion label Pigalle and art firm Ill-Studio, which was first unveiled in 2015 and recently repainted–with help from Nike. Now the rubberized court, walls and hoops in Paris’ ninth arrondissement all have a sunset color scheme that Pigalle and Ill-Studio call their “interpretation of the future aesthetics of basketball and sport in general.”
